全面剖析:深入解读某主题的多维度分析与详细探讨
《8数码问题中启发函数f(x)=g(x)+h(x)里g(x)的含义探寻》
在8数码问题的求解过程中,启发函数f(x)=g(x)+h(x)起着至关重要的作用。其中,g(x)有着独特的含义。它代表的是C节点x与目标状态位置相同的棋子个数。这一概念看似简单,实则蕴含着深刻的逻辑。通过计算g(x),我们可以了解当前节点与目标状态在棋子位置匹配方面的相似程度。当g(x)的值较大时,意味着当前节点与目标状态有更多的棋子处于相同位置,这在一定程度上暗示了当前节点距离目标状态可能更近。而h(x)则更多地考虑了其他因素,二者共同构成了启发函数f(x),引导搜索算法更高效地寻找到从初始状态到目标状态的最优路径。对g(x)的准确理解和运用,是解决8数码问题的关键之一,它为算法提供了重要的参考依据,帮助减少不必要的搜索空间,提高解题效率。
免责声明:
以上内容除特别注明外均来源于网友提问,创作工场回答,未经许可,严谨转载。